The objective of this seminar is to describe key elements of Inspection Orders, and the Review process by Fire Marshal Delegates. The information provided should benefit all stakeholders in understanding the contents of an Inspection Order and the Fire Marshal Review, including expectations for documentation to support Inspection Orders or appeals in the Review process. Case studies will be used to illustrate common themes, issues, and Decisions.
